Muscle Engagement In Different Strokes

Each swimming stroke uses muscles differently. Freestyle mainly works the shoulders, arms, and core. Breaststroke focuses more on the chest, thighs, and calves. Backstroke engages the back muscles and legs. Butterfly stroke is the most intense, involving the entire upper body and core. Changing strokes helps develop balanced muscle growth.

Comparing Swimming To Traditional Weight Training

Comparing swimming to traditional weight training reveals clear differences in how each builds muscle. Both activities improve strength but target muscles differently. Understanding these distinctions helps choose the best approach for muscle growth and overall fitness.

Muscle Hypertrophy Differences

Weight training focuses on lifting heavy loads to break muscle fibers. This process creates muscle hypertrophy, or muscle growth. Swimming uses water resistance, which is gentler on muscles. It builds endurance and tone but usually causes less muscle size increase.

Benefits Of Low-impact Resistance

Swimming offers low-impact resistance that protects joints and reduces injury risk. The water supports body weight, easing stress on bones. This makes swimming ideal for people with joint problems or arthritis. It also improves cardiovascular health while strengthening muscles.

Limitations For Maximum Muscle Gain

Swimming alone rarely produces large muscle gains like weightlifting. Water resistance is constant but not heavy enough to maximize hypertrophy. Swimmers may need extra weight training to build bulk. Muscle gain depends on workout intensity, volume, and recovery time.

Incorporating Sprint Intervals

Sprint intervals involve swimming at maximum speed for short bursts. These high-intensity efforts activate fast-twitch muscle fibers responsible for growth. Rest periods between sprints help muscles recover and prepare for the next burst.

Try sets like 25 to 50 meters at full speed, followed by a rest. Repeat several times to increase muscle fatigue and encourage growth. Sprinting also boosts metabolism, supporting muscle repair.

Using Swim Equipment For Resistance

Swim gear adds extra resistance, making muscles work harder. Tools like paddles, fins, and drag suits increase water resistance. This resistance forces muscles to generate more power during each stroke.

  • Paddles enlarge hand surface area, improving upper body strength.
  • Fins increase leg resistance, building stronger calves and thighs.
  • Drag suits create extra drag, enhancing overall muscle effort.

Incorporate these tools gradually to avoid strain. Focus on controlled movements to maximize muscle engagement.

Combining Swimming With Strength Training

Strength training complements swimming by targeting muscles with heavier loads. Weight lifting or bodyweight exercises build muscle mass faster. Swimming then enhances muscle endurance and flexibility.

Plan workouts to alternate swimming days with strength training. Focus on compound exercises like squats, push-ups, and pull-ups. This combination improves overall muscle size and performance.

Protein Intake For Muscle Repair

Your muscles need protein to repair tiny tears caused by intense swimming. Aim to include high-quality protein sources like lean meats, eggs, dairy, or plant-based options such as beans and lentils in your daily meals.
